By: Drake DeMuyt | January 23, 2026
We want to share a proactive winter weather update as we head into the weekend. A winter storm system is forecasted to move into our region January 24–25. While forecasts are still developing and specific impacts may shift, this system could bring snow and/or ice accumulation and hazardous travel conditions.
This message is not meant to create concern—only to support preparedness and good decision-making. Winter weather is something we can navigate well when we plan ahead.
